【affect3d总共几部分别叫什么】Affect3D 是一款专注于情感计算与面部动作单元(Action Units, AUs)识别的深度学习模型,广泛应用于人机交互、虚拟现实、情绪分析等领域。该模型由多个模块组成,每个模块在整体系统中承担不同的功能。了解其组成部分有助于更好地理解其工作原理和应用场景。
以下是对 Affect3D 模型结构的总结:
Affect3D 的组成部分
Affect3D 主要由 五个核心部分 构成,分别负责图像输入、特征提取、3D 建模、情感分析和结果输出。以下是各部分的具体名称及功能说明:
序号 | 部分名称 | 功能说明 |
1 | 图像输入模块 | 负责接收原始图像或视频流,作为模型的输入数据。 |
2 | 特征提取模块 | 使用卷积神经网络(CNN)对输入图像进行特征提取,识别面部关键点和局部特征。 |
3 | 3D 建模模块 | 将2D图像信息转换为3D人脸模型,增强表情识别的准确性。 |
4 | 情感分析模块 | 基于提取的面部特征和3D模型,判断用户当前的情绪状态(如快乐、悲伤等)。 |
5 | 结果输出模块 | 将最终的情感分析结果以可视化或数据形式输出,供后续应用使用。 |
总结
Affect3D 作为一个多模块协同工作的系统,通过图像输入、特征提取、3D建模、情感分析和结果输出五大模块,实现了对人类面部表情的精准识别与情绪判断。这种分层结构不仅提高了模型的鲁棒性,也为不同应用场景提供了灵活的接口和扩展空间。